@Swed @Savage Princess Little One

 

With respect to seeing comments made by other voters:

 

It certainly can be helpful for voters but it can also go toxic very quickly.

 

The recruit will still be able to see your comments made to them but other members won't be (except some Staff to monitor any shit disturbers or abusive comments).

 

If you don't know the person you're voting on, maybe you shouldn't be voting for them at all? Take the time to get to know the recruits and form your own opinion of them. We've reduced the number of votes needed (see reform) in order to coincide with the amount of people that will know who the recruit is enough to form their own opinion.

 

This will reduce bandwagoning and circlejerking issues that we currently see.
